Estate Planning Cases in Shoreline, WA

Estate planning in Shoreline, Washington requires careful attention to both state law and local King County court procedures. Located just north of Seattle, Shoreline residents often have complex estates involving real property, retirement accounts, and business interests that require sophisticated planning strategies. Washington's community property laws and lack of state income tax create unique opportunities for tax-efficient estate planning. Local attorneys understand how King County Superior Court handles probate matters and can help structure your estate plan accordingly.

Washington Estate Planning Laws & Deadlines

Washington operates under community property laws, meaning assets acquired during marriage are generally owned equally by both spouses. The state has no inheritance tax and benefits from the federal estate tax exemption of $12.92 million per person in 2023. Washington's probate code allows for simplified procedures for smaller estates under $100,000, but larger estates require formal probate administration through King County Superior Court.

Do I need an estate plan if I live in Shoreline and own property in King County?
Yes, Shoreline residents with real property should have an estate plan to avoid probate delays in King County Superior Court. Washington's community property laws also make planning essential for married couples to ensure proper asset distribution.
How does Washington's lack of state income tax affect my estate planning?
Washington's tax-friendly environment allows for more flexible estate planning strategies, but federal estate taxes may still apply to larger estates. Your Shoreline attorney can help structure plans to maximize these tax advantages while ensuring compliance with federal requirements.
